Output f80a6904e065dba43fb438b8a7a2f2f1f1f10f35cf66477b0e1702f2ac6dea19:0

value
10519169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9be40c4170293d0b3e68fdec2e2a27bd2e30a3e OP_EQUAL
address
3MYLUBRm1PpoZjpZxMaXK9bcqeKw3KhqtY
transaction
f80a6904e065dba43fb438b8a7a2f2f1f1f10f35cf66477b0e1702f2ac6dea19
spent
true